Transaction 23528f287cf893f37e1e267266fcd614d0b1dbb242a23fc8be704a20adcc7614
1 Input
1 Output
-
23528f287cf893f37e1e267266fcd614d0b1dbb242a23fc8be704a20adcc7614:0
- value
- 116541402
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ff62c5dbe3da6b716298f18e09dd3d353905ac1b
- address
- bc1qla3vtklrmf4hzc5c7x8qnhfax5usttqm02wedw